
52-year-old woman arraigned for allegedly using 13 children to solicit for alms
A 52-year-old woman, Angela Nzewi, has been arraigned before Children, Sexual and Gender-based Violence Offences Court in Awka, Anambra State, for allegedly using 13 children to solicit for alms.
Penpushing reports that the police prosecutor, Chinyere Okechukwu, told the court that the accused from Otolo Nnewi, committed the offence on December 21, 2024 at Nnewi, stressing that she did obtain 13 children for the purpose of soliciting for alms.
The police inspector, added that the offence contravened Section 33(1) of the Child Rights Law of Anambra State 2004, while the accused pleaded not guilty to the charge when read to her at the courtroom
Penpushing further reports that the Chief Magistrate, U.E. Onochie, however, granted the defendant N200,000 bail with a surety in like sum and thereafter adjourned the case until March 19, 2025 for a hearing.
